Modulators are essential in laser systems, playing an essential duty in transforming constant wave results right into pulse formats. Acousto-optic Q-switch modulators offer this exact purpose, allowing rapid modulation of laser results, which results in high-peak power pulses.

The difference between acousto-optic buttons and modulators is a crucial element of comprehending how these devices work in different situations. Acousto-optic switches effectively reroute light beam of lights, therefore making it possible for numerous transmitting performances within optical systems. On the other hand, a modulator changes the light’s buildings, straight influencing the beam’s qualities. This distinction delineates their corresponding roles in laser systems and highlights the diversity of applications each device deals with.

Acoustic optical deflectors add to the convenience of optical systems, supplying a way to control light dynamically and successfully by utilizing acoustic waves as the managing system. Such devices can be located in numerous applications, from laser scanning systems to sophisticated imaging techniques. By making use of the principles of acousto-optics, these deflectors aid in accomplishing quick and accurate modifications in the light beam’s trajectory without the requirement for intricate mechanical components.
